CVE-2026-69306
Visual Studio Code vulnerability analysis and mitigation

Overview

CVE-2026-69306 is a security feature bypass vulnerability in Microsoft Visual Studio Code caused by a "failing open" condition (CWE-636). When VS Code encounters certain error or failure conditions, it falls back to a less secure state, allowing an unauthenticated network attacker to bypass a security feature with user interaction required. All versions of Visual Studio Code prior to 1.132.1 are affected. The vulnerability was disclosed and patched on August 11, 2026, with a CVSS v3.1 base score of 8.2 (High) (Microsoft MSRC, GitHub Advisory).

Technical details

The root cause is classified as CWE-636 (Not Failing Securely / 'Failing Open'), meaning that when Visual Studio Code encounters an error or failure condition in a security-relevant code path, it defaults to a permissive state rather than a secure one. This allows an attacker operating over the network to exploit the failure condition to bypass an intended security control. User interaction is required for exploitation, suggesting the attack may involve a malicious file, workspace, or remote resource that triggers the insecure fallback behavior. No public technical write-up or proof-of-concept code has been identified at this time (Microsoft MSRC, GitHub Advisory).

Impact

Successful exploitation results in a changed scope impact, with high confidentiality impact and low integrity impact — meaning an attacker could gain unauthorized access to sensitive information accessible within or beyond the VS Code security boundary, and may make limited unauthorized modifications. Availability is not impacted. The network attack vector and changed scope indicate that exploitation could affect resources or data beyond the VS Code process itself, potentially exposing developer credentials, source code, or environment secrets (Microsoft MSRC, GitHub Advisory).

Exploitability

There is no known public proof-of-concept exploit and no confirmed in-the-wild exploitation as of the time of disclosure (Microsoft MSRC). The EPSS score is approximately 0.41% (34th percentile), indicating a low near-term probability of exploitation. The NVD SSVC assessment classifies exploitation as "none" and technical impact as "partial." The vulnerability is not listed in the CISA Known Exploited Vulnerabilities (KEV) catalog. No threat actor attribution has been reported.

Mitigation and workarounds

Microsoft has released a patch in Visual Studio Code version 1.132.1, which resolves this vulnerability. Users and administrators should update VS Code to version 1.132.1 or later immediately via the built-in update mechanism or by downloading the latest release from the official Microsoft website. No configuration-based workaround has been published; upgrading is the recommended and only confirmed remediation (Microsoft MSRC, GitHub Advisory).
